#4bb0d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bb0d0 is composed of 29.4% red, 69%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.9% cyan, 15.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 194.4 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 55.5%. #4bb0d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ffff with #0061a1.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#4bb0d0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020507 is the darkest color, while #f6f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bb0d0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#889093 is the less saturated color, while #1fc7fc is the most saturated one.
